Field Management & Big Data: Boosting Yield & Efficiency
The confluence of advanced field management techniques and the sheer volume of data generated by modern gas operations presents an unprecedented opportunity to improve production and performance. Big data analytics, encompassing everything from seismic imagery and well logs to production history and real-time sensor data, allows engineers to create far more precise models of subsurface field behavior. This, in turn, enables optimized decisions related to well placement, hydraulic design, waterflooding strategies, and artificial lift optimization. Employing machine learning algorithms within a big data framework can anticipate future production declines, identify potential well failures before they occur, and even uncover previously unknown sweet spots within the field. Ultimately, the intelligent use of big data in field management translates into higher profitability and a more sustainable approach to energy extraction.
